Las Vegas man dies days after crash in central valley: police

- Advertisement -

LAS VEGAS (KLAS) – A Las Vegas man has died days after he was injured in a crash within the central valley.

It occurred on April 5 round 4:20 a.m. when Nevada State Freeway troopers responded to the scene.

A Chrysler sedan was touring northbound on I-15 close to Charleston simply south of Neon Gateway. The driving force of the Chrysler did not drive throughout the marked journey lanes and traveled left, and hit a concrete barrier wall, police stated.

The Chrysler then entered the intersection of northbound I-15 and Neon Gateway, touring over a curb and hitting a delineator submit. The Chrysler then continued into the westbound journey lanes of Neon Gateway and the surface paved shoulder, hitting a concrete barrier. The Chrysler got here to a cease on-top of a concrete barrier alongside the Neon Gateway, in line with police.

The driving force of the Chrysler was later recognized by police as, Adam Wesley Armstrong, 26, was taken to a hospital, the place he was later pronounced useless 4 days afterward April 9, police stated.
